1 – Do Those Little Decorations You’ve Been Putting Off

The biggest thing you can do to help your property shine for prospective buyers is to do those touch-ups and decoration jobs you’ve been putting on the back burner for months. It can be hard juggling your daily life with the selling process, and the thought of adding lots of home renovations to that list may be daunting.

That’s why we recommend focusing on the little things instead!

Fresh Lick Of Paint

You’ve probably heard it a million times, but there’s a reason estate agents keep telling people to give their home a fresh coat of paint: it works!

Nothing rejuvenates a room like a lick of paint. Not only does it cover up annoying little stains like little dirty fingerprints or shoe scuff marks, but it also creates a clean, fresh backdrop throughout your home. Of course, paint within reason. Bright or bold colours aren’t always the best choice. Instead, stick to neutral and light tones that open up a room and allow viewers to imagine their own style.

Forgotten Repairs

Every home has those little areas that are awaiting improvement. Whether it’s a lifting corner of wallpaper, a broken door handle or a noticeable stain, don’t put off repairs any longer. Now is the best time to do those small jobs that would otherwise be forgotten. 

The best way to judge whether a repair will add value to your home is to put yourself in the shoes of a prospective buyer. Step through your front door with fresh eyes. The wonky cupboard or squeaky internal door may not bother you, but it could be the first thing a prospective buyer’s attention is drawn to. 

Update Your Kitchen & Bathroom Decor

In many cases, it’s the kitchen and bathroom that people like to see when buying a house. If your kitchen or bathroom looks lacklustre or especially outdated, it’s definitely worth addressing. 

Don’t worry! You don’t need to splash the cash on a whole new bathroom suite. Much of the time all that’s needed is a thorough, deep clean and some decor finishing touches, like stick-on tiles, new bath mats or attractive shelving. Simply reducing clutter and things on show can add instant space – and saves you time when it comes to packing up to move!

2 – Give Your Garden Extra Attention

When you first bought or built your home, was your garden a big bonus or a must-have feature? It may be for your next buyers! That’s why it’s important not to overlook your garden. 

No matter what size or style of garden you have, from acres to a small space outside your front door, your garden can be a major selling point. A beautiful, neat garden has the benefit of adding curb appeal, making your home instantly more attractive before viewers even step foot inside. 

One of the most value-adding things you can do to your garden is to keep it clear of litter, dog mess or unwanted garden items. It’s easy to overlook a rusting swing set or a compost area that’s become unmanageable. But potential home buyers will notice things like this, and make a negative judgement about the house or area.

Cutting back wild or untamed bushes and weeds is another easy way to create a more manageable and clean-looking garden space quickly. Just imagine the garden you’d be looking for when buying your next home. Many families are especially interested in a well-kept, low-maintenance, functional garden.

3 – Instantly Add Value With Home Staging

You may have heard of home staging, but how can it increase the value of your property?

In a nutshell, staging turns a house into a home, making it easier for prospective buyers to imagine themselves living in your property. If you can give people house envy, you easily add value to your property, as they see your home as something to aspire to and wish for!

Home staging puts together the crucial elements that can turn property viewers into high-value offers. Staging includes everything from stylish furnishings, rugs, lamps and tables to artwork and scented candles.
